Mr Price is a representative from the National Emergency Management Agency (Nema) in New Zealand, recently in the news for commenting on the importance of public safety during a tsunami advisory. He expressed concern over individuals engaging in activities like mowing grass near coastal areas despite warnings, emphasizing that complacency in such situations could endanger lives and put first responders at risk. His statements reflect the agency's commitment to ensuring that New Zealanders remain safe during natural disaster alerts.
